WebIn Iowa, it's called a fictitious name. You may decide to use an Iowa fictitious name for a variety of reasons. For example, your business might be called Midwest Marketing Solutions, LLC, and under that company, you have an event planning business called Midwest Events. You could file for a fictitious business name just for that company. WebClaiming a company name in Iowa; Other things to Know In Iowa, it is important that you request for a Fictitious Name/DBA name in addition to the original business name because it allows your new or existing business to do business with a … Web23 mrt. 2024 · Changing the name of a business in Iowa can be done in two ways: by filing for a trade/fictitious name or by submitting an amendment to the legal name of an existing business. The first method, filing for a trade/fictitious name (also known as a DBA name), is the easiest way to operate your business using a different name without needing to ... Web16 jan. 2024 · A fictitious name is a name other than your proper legal business entity name that you formally get permission from the state (or county) to use when conducting business.
